It's That Time Of Year!

The Emory women's soccer team has been had at work since Aug. 19 in preparation for the 2011 campaign.  The Eagles  are coming off a stellar effort last season,   reaching the quarterfinals of the NCAA Division III Championships last season for the first time in school history, while posting a won-lost mark of 16-2-4 along with a No. 5 national ranking.   

Recently, the team was picked, along with the University of Chicago, to finish first in the University Athletic Association (UAA) in 2011, according to the conference's preseason coaches' poll.

“The team has been competing hard and we have had some good training sessions,” assistant coach Rachel Moreland stated.  “Our veterans have done a great job of getting the younger players acclimated and the team is getting better and better everyday.”

Emory will open its season on Saturday, Sept. 3, at Chapman University in Orange, California.
